    Who is Dr. Cortese, Foot & Ankle Surgeon in Normal, IL?

    Dr. Craig Cortese is a Foot & Ankle Surgeon, who primarily practices in Normal, IL with 2 additional practice locations. He is board certified. Dr. Cortese graduated from Dr. William M. Scholl College of Podiatric Medicine, Chicago, Illinois. Dr. Cortese is fluent in English, Italian, and Spanish, and is currently seeing new patients.     What is Dr. Craig Cortese's specialty?

    Dr. Cortese is a Foot & Ankle Surgeon near Normal, IL. Podiatrist with specialization in foot and ankle surgery has expertise in diagnosing and treating conditions affecting the foot, ankle, and lower extremities. This includes both surgical and non-surgical approaches for issues like fractures, deformities, and arthritis, with a focus on improving mobility and foot health.
